Output e8fef044737f53f593d26678be85fd6234e99555237d43cc03979e4a0f334858:0

value
34653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c50c6c7534dd9784a1da7f94c9ded40e388bbd OP_EQUAL
address
3QTgEUsidrebgFtGTFChg3Yaq8D5ao1gUF
transaction
e8fef044737f53f593d26678be85fd6234e99555237d43cc03979e4a0f334858
spent
true